How Much Does a Product Development Manager Make in Nepal?

A Product Development Manager working in Nepal will typically earn around 1,391,600 NPR per year, and this can range from the lowest average salary of about 695,400 NPR to the highest average salary of 2,146,100 NPR.

Product Development Manager Salary by Experience Level in Nepal

The most important factor in determining your salary after the specific profession is the number of years experience you have. It stands to reason that more years of experience will result in a higher wage.

We have researched the average product development manager salary based on years of experience to give you an idea of how the average changes once you've worked for a certain amount of time.

  • 0 - 2 Years Experience. A Product Development Manager in Nepal that has less than two years of experience can expect to earn somewhere in the region of 832,300 NPR.
  • 2 - 5 Years Experience. With two to five years of experience the average Product Development Manager salary would increase to 1,104,400 NPR.
  • 5 - 10 Years Experience. From five to ten years of experience as a Product Development Manager, the average salary would be 1,476,700 NPR.
  • 10 - 15 Years Experience. Once you have more than ten years of experience the average salary reaches around 1,765,300 NPR.
  • 15 - 20 Years Experience. A Product Development Manager with 15 to 20 years of experience can earn an average of 1,896,700 NPR.
  • 20+ Years Experience. For a Product Development Manager with more than 20 years, the expected average salary increases to 2,038,500 NPR.

Product Development Manager Salary by Education Level in Nepal

As well as experience in a job, your education plays a big role in how much you can earn. A lot of higher paying positions require a high level of education, but how much can a degree increase your salary?

In our research we have compared the salaries of employees in the same job and career level with different levels of education to see how much more you can earn at each education level.

The salary you can earn based on your education is very specific to both your location and the career path you choose.

In our research, we looked at the average salary for a Product Development Manager in Nepal based on the education level of the employees in order to find out whether a better education level would increase your salary.

  • High School. A Product Development Manager in Nepal with a high school education can earn an average salary of 1,043,600 NPR.

  • Certificate or Diploma. A Product Development Manager in Nepal with a certificate or diploma education can earn an average salary of 1,191,100 NPR.

  • Bachelor's Degree. A Product Development Manager in Nepal with a bachelor's degree education can earn an average salary of 1,621,400 NPR.

  • Master's Degree. A Product Development Manager in Nepal with a master's degree education can earn an average salary of 2,038,500 NPR.

Product Development Manager Salary Compared by Gender

In the modern age, we know that there should never be a pay gap between men and women. Unfortunately, in many professions, there is still a significant difference between the salaries earned by men when compared to the salary of women in the same job.

In Nepal, a male product development manager will earn an average of 1,428,800 NPR, while a female product development manager will earn around 1,345,400 NPR.

This means that a male product development manager earns approximately 6% more than a female product development manager for performing the same job.

Product Development Manager Average Pay Raise in Nepal

In many countries, an annual pay raise is often given to employees to reward their service with a salary increase.

From our research, we can see that the average pay raise for a Product Development Manager in Nepal is around 9% every 28 months.

The national average pay raise across all professions and industries in Nepal is around 4% every 29 months.

In this case, we can see that the number of months between the average pay raise is higher than the typical 12 months.

To make the data more meaningful, we can calculate what the approximate annual pay raise would be using a simple formula:

Annual Increase = ( Increase Rate ÷ Months ) × 12

So for this example, it would be:

Annual Increase = ( 9 ÷ 28 ) × 12  = 4%

What this means is that a Product Development Manager in Nepal can expect to receive an average pay raise of around 4% every 12 months.

Product Development Manager Bonus and Incentive Rates in Nepal

Another part of your overall compensation in a job is how much bonus you receive. Some job roles will be more likely to pay a bonus than others and also more likely to have higher bonus rates.

Generally speaking, jobs that are more involved with direct revenue generation will receive higher bonuses based on the performance towards revenue goals.

A Product Development Manager is a moderate bonus based job, with 63% of employees reporting at least one bonus in the last 12 months.

37% reported that they had not received any bonuses in the previous 12 months.

For the employees that did receive a bonus in the previous 12 months, the reported bonuses ranged from 5% to 8%.

What are the Types of Bonus?

There are a number of difference types of bonus you can receive in a job. Including:

  • Individual performance bonus - This is a bonus that is awarded to an individual employee for general performance in the job. It's the most common type of bonus.
  • Company performance bonus - This is a bonus that is awarded to a company employees to share profit with the staff.
  • Goal based bonus - This is a bonus that is awarded to an individual employee (or a team) for achieving specific goals, objectives, or milestones.
  • Holiday bonus - This type of bonus is usually paid around the holidays, often the end of the year, and is a token of appreciation for the hard work throughout the year.
